Transaction 0865122a5339689de40676e02c916cc58f6708f13b7860cfd1de834b933c2552
1 Input
1 Output
-
0865122a5339689de40676e02c916cc58f6708f13b7860cfd1de834b933c2552:0
- value
- 1878143
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1512f6c4c8d31035576c19f7974905b049b22680 OP_EQUAL
- address
- 33cSqD8DGTQVfRTFDHti68wUEL8SpHnJuT